Sattari firing case: Air gun seized after combing Op

PANAJI

In a significant development in the recent gunshot incident at Podoshe, Sattari, Valpoi Police seized an air gun from the house of one Nandkumar Apte, who admitted to firing the shot.

Police confirmed that Apte did not hold any license for the weapon and had been using it illegally.

North Goa SP Harish Madkaikar said that Valpoi police, assisted by the Forensic Science Laboratory (FSL) team, carried out an extensive combing operation in the Housing Board area at Zariwada, Podoshe following the gun shot incident -- the second in the area.

During the search at House No. 131/13, conducted in the presence of owner Apte, officers found nothing suspicious. However, police noticed a locked storeroom adjacent to the house. When Apte refused to unlock it, the police broke open the door.

“Inside the storeroom, the team discovered a blue barrel containing a long bag, which concealed a high-powered professional air gun fitted with a scope,” SP said in a statement issued.

Madkaikar said the accused later admitted to firing the shots. “During interrogation, he confessed to both incidents, saying he opened fire to scare off people who gathered late at night for drinking and other illegal activities,” he added.

Police have issued Apte a notice under Section 35(3) and directed him to cooperate with the investigation.
